How Software Development Services Ensure Data Security

The Ultimate Guide to Managed IT Services Why Your Business Needs Them

Data security has become a paramount concern in today’s digital landscape. With cyber threats evolving rapidly, protecting sensitive information from breaches and unauthorised access is essential. Businesses must ensure their software applications safeguard data effectively, and this is where software development services like Innerworks play a crucial role. Innerworks focuses on integrating data security measures at every stage, providing clients with peace of mind that their information is well protected.

Understanding the Risks: Why Data Security Matters

Recent years have seen numerous high-profile data breaches that have exposed personal, financial, and corporate information. These incidents not only lead to significant financial loss but also damage brand reputation and invite legal repercussions. Sensitive data such as customer details, payment information, and intellectual property require robust protection. Innerworks understands these risks and designs software solutions that prioritise the confidentiality and integrity of such critical data.

How Software Development Services Ensure Data Security from Day One

Innerworks embeds security into the software development life cycle (SDLC) from the outset. This approach begins with thorough risk assessments and security-focused planning. By adopting the “privacy by design” principle, Innerworks ensures software architecture incorporates strong safeguards against vulnerabilities. This early integration of security measures helps prevent costly fixes later and provides clients with resilient applications tailored to their specific needs.

Secure Coding Practices in Custom Software Development

One of the cornerstones of data security in software is secure coding. Innerworks follows established guidelines, including those from OWASP, to minimise common vulnerabilities. Developers at Innerworks employ techniques such as rigorous input validation, output encoding, and strong authentication processes to defend against attacks like SQL injection or cross-site scripting. Additionally, Innerworks conducts regular code reviews and utilises static code analysis tools to detect and address potential security flaws proactively.

Data Encryption and Secure Communication

Protecting data both at rest and during transmission is vital. Innerworks integrates advanced encryption protocols to secure sensitive information stored within applications and ensures all communication channels use secure protocols like HTTPS, TLS, and SSL. By encrypting data end-to-end, Innerworks mitigates the risk of interception or tampering, maintaining the confidentiality and trustworthiness of client data.

DevSecOps: Continuous Security in the Development Pipeline

Innerworks embraces the DevSecOps methodology, which integrates security into the continuous integration and continuous deployment (CI/CD) pipeline. This practice automates security checks and vulnerability assessments throughout development, allowing Innerworks to identify and fix issues early. DevSecOps ensures that security is not an afterthought but an ongoing process, which results in more secure and reliable software releases.

Compliance with Industry Standards and Regulations

Compliance with data protection regulations such as GDPR, HIPAA, and ISO 27001 is a critical aspect of software security. Innerworks ensures that every project aligns with these standards, helping clients meet legal obligations while safeguarding user privacy. Innerworks also implements access control measures, data minimisation practices, and audit trails to maintain accountability and transparency, which are essential for regulatory compliance.

Ongoing Monitoring and Security Updates

Security does not end with deployment. Innerworks provides continuous monitoring and regular security audits to detect emerging threats and vulnerabilities. When new risks are identified, Innerworks promptly delivers patches and updates to protect client applications. Furthermore, Innerworks prepares incident response plans that enable swift action in the event of a security breach, reducing potential damage and downtime.

Client Education and Security Awareness

Innerworks recognises that software security is a shared responsibility. The company offers guidance and training to clients on best practices such as strong password policies, access management, and recognising phishing attempts. By fostering a security-aware culture, Innerworks helps businesses empower their teams to contribute to maintaining data security in everyday operations.

Choosing the Right Software Development Partner for Security

Selecting a software development service that prioritises security is crucial. Innerworks stands out through its extensive experience, certifications, and use of cutting-edge security tools. Prospective clients should inquire about a partner’s security protocols, compliance expertise, and incident response capabilities. Innerworks consistently demonstrates its commitment to data security, making it a trustworthy partner for any organisation looking to protect its digital assets.

Building Software with Security at Its Core

Innerworks ensures data security by integrating best practices into every phase of software development. From secure coding and encryption to DevSecOps and compliance, Innerworks provides comprehensive protection against today’s complex cyber threats. Partnering with Innerworks means building software with security at its heart, safeguarding your business and your customers’ data in an increasingly connected world.

Table of Contents

You might also enjoy